Several Gillingham players are nursing injuries ahead of the trip to Port Vale.

Gills boss Martin Allen will definitely be without the suspended Bradley Dack (pictured) on Saturday while both Jack Payne (groin) and Myles Weston (back) failed fitness tests ahead of Tuesday night’s win over Southend and will be assessed again before the trip north.

Charlie Lee could be a doubt after hobbling off with a leg injury against Southend.

But despite a busy week for physio James Barker, the Gills boss knows he still has plenty of options.

"It’s testimony to the squad that we have got (that) we can all pull together and still do it," said Allen.

"We will get everyone back together and see who is fit for the journey up north."

The Gills faced a tough midweek match but Allen rubbished suggestions his side will be feeling the effects after playing 45 minutes with 10 men.

"The players won’t be tired, they don’t get tired," he said.

"They were in Thursday, we travel Friday and we will train up there in the afternoon."
